Chemistry Check: Assessing Compatibility With Local Singles

Start by treating attraction as an invitation to learn, not a verdict. When you meet local singles on Mingle2, look for signs that you share core values and a compatible lifestyle before accelerating a relationship.

Key Areas To Explore

  • Shared values: Ask about priorities like family, work-life balance, finances, and how they make decisions. Simple questions—“What matters most to you on a weeknight?” or “How do you handle major financial choices?”—reveal whether your long-term priorities align.
  • Lifestyle fit: Talk about daily routines, social habits, and hobbies. If one of you loves late nights out and the other needs early mornings for work, that’s solvable if you both acknowledge it early.
  • Relationship goals: Be clear about timeline and intent. Ask whether they see short-term dating, exclusivity, marriage, or parenting in their near future. It’s okay for goals to differ—what matters is knowing where you both stand.
  • Communication style: Notice how they handle small disagreements and emotional topics. Do they prefer direct talk, written messages, or time to process? Matching on how you speak about needs and problems prevents common friction.
  • Boundaries and respect: Discuss boundaries around time, privacy, finances, and family. Ask how they prefer to set and adjust boundaries so you both feel comfortable and respected.

Practical Questions To Ask Early

  1. “What does a healthy relationship look like to you?”
  2. “How do you like to spend a typical weekend?”
  3. “What are your long-term plans for work, living situation, or family?”
  4. “When you’re upset, how can someone best support you?”
  5. “Are there deal-breakers I should know about?”

Use these questions as conversation starters rather than checklists. Pay attention to consistency between words and actions: a person who says they value closeness but cancels plans often may need a different pace. Trust your judgment, protect your boundaries, and share your honest answers—clarity early on saves time and reduces hurt later.

Finally, remember that chemistry can grow. If core values and communication align, small differences in routine or preferences can be negotiated. If fundamental goals or values clash, it’s kinder to both people to acknowledge that and move on. Approach each conversation with curiosity, respect, and clear intent to find whether a real, sustainable connection can form.

Dating Confidence Reset

Start small and focus on clear, simple goals for your time on Mingle2. Decide what you want from a conversation — a friendly chat, a casual date, or something serious — and use that goal to guide how you reply, who you invest time in, and when you move a chat offline.

Set realistic expectations. Not every match will click, and that’s normal. Treat messages that don’t go anywhere as information, not failure. Each interaction teaches you what you like, what you don’t, and how to spot better fits faster.

Pace conversations with purpose. Match the other person’s level of engagement early on. Respond in a way that feels natural to you, and avoid rushing to intense topics or quick commitments. Give a new chat a few messages to show its shape before deciding whether to continue or step back.

Choose quality over quantity. Resist the numbers-game impulse to message endlessly. Spend a little more time on profiles that align with your values and interests, and start conversations that reference something specific from their profile — it shows attention and raises the chance of a real connection.

Track small wins and protect your energy. Notice progress that isn’t binary: a thoughtful reply, a two-way conversation, exchanging photos, or setting a time to meet. When interactions feel draining or disrespectful, politely disengage. Your time and boundaries matter.

Stay steady emotionally. If a message doesn’t get a reply or a date falls through, pause before reacting. Take a breath, reflect on what you want next, and move on with intention. Practicing calm responses keeps you in control and makes future conversations healthier.
